VIN 500
VIN 500 is currently displayed in the Crawford Auto Aviation museum in Cleveland, Ohio.

This car is unique as it is ‘allegedly’ the first car off of the Dunmurry production line.
We say ‘allegedly’ because it is not the first car off the line – it’s actually the second.
Just before the media arrived to photograph the first DeLorean off the line, the original VIN 500 suffered a brake problem and was crashed into a wall by
Lotus engineer Mike Foxten. In a panic, the company quickly switched the VIN tags with VIN 501, and presented VIN 501 as VIN 500 – thus saving face.
The real VIN 500 was subsequently fixed and retagged with a different VIN number.
This effectively shifted all of the VIN numbers by one digit.
VIN 500 is actually VIN 501
VIN 501 is actually VIN 502
VIN 502 is actually VIN 503
Etc
Despite not being the true first car off the production line at Dunmurry, VIN 500 is available for all to see in the Crawford museum – another important part of DeLorean history preserved for future generations.
